What Is RTP?

Return to Player is a percentage that indicates how much money a slot machine returns to players over an extended period. For example, a slot with an RTP of 96% will theoretically return $96 for every $100 wagered. This means the house edge is only 4%, which is relatively favorable compared to other casino games.

Why RTP Matters

Understanding RTP helps you choose games that offer better odds. Most reputable online casinos display this information clearly. Slots with higher RTPs—typically 95% or above—give you a statistical advantage over time. However, remember that RTP is calculated over thousands of spins, so short-term results may vary significantly.
